A Release of Information (ROI) form template is a legal document authorizing the sharing of personal data, most commonly medical records (Protected Health Information or PHI) or educational records, allowing you to specify who gets the info, what info is released, when, and for what purpose.
The purpose of a release of information form template is to give healthcare providers legal permission to share a patient’s medical information with specified individuals or organizations. It protects patient privacy by clearly outlining what data can be disclosed, who can receive it, and the timeframe of authorization, ensuring compliance with HIPAA regulations.
Additionally, this free editable release of information form template supports smooth care coordination and administrative processes, such as referrals, insurance claims, or legal requests. By documenting patient consent, it reduces misunderstandings, prevents unauthorized disclosures, and helps healthcare teams exchange information responsibly and efficiently.

A signed release of information form is required to legally share a patient’s medical information with third parties, such as other healthcare providers, insurance companies, or family members. It ensures patient consent, protects privacy rights, and helps healthcare organizations remain compliant with HIPAA and other legal regulations.
